Im 5'6", 150lbs, is this a good ski for me to use on the east coast? I mostly ski Sugarloaf and Saddleback, and avoid groomers at all costs. Does it handle ice/hardpack/death cookies? What size should I get.

My experience is in the Midwest and Western states. The Gotamas are to much ski for Michigan. They require more than 3 or 4 hundred feet of vertical to wake them up. I skied them at Jackson Hole and they can chew up any ice/hardpack/death cookies you can throw at them and naturally yearn for Pow. 150 is pretty light. Lean to the shorter size if your wavering. Tech Specs:
- Lengths:
- 168cm, 176cm, 183cm, 190cm
- Dimensions:
- 133 / 105 / 124mm
- Turn Radius:
- [168cm] 21.1m; [176cm] 23.5m; [183cm] 29.5m [190cm] 28.5m
- Construction:
- Power, tough box
- Core Material:
- Multi-layer wood
- Tail:
- Twintip
- Binding System:
- No
- Binding Included:
- No
- Recommended Binding:
- No
- Recommended Use:
- Expert, powder-oriented big-mountain freeride
- Manufacturer Warranty:
- 1 Year
